Chapter 53 My Dear Daughter



The high-heeled boots tried to fall down several times, but could not fall down even 0.5 millimeters.

Finally, he gave up, stepped aside, and stepped on the wood-grain marble floor with a "thump" sound.

"Good job! Someone actually dared to stop me and kick people. You are really brave." The voice was as clear as the rainbow spring. Even when he was sneering, the voice sounded so gorgeous.

She wasn't singing, and her voice didn't sound like singing, but her voice made people think that this person must have a very beautiful singing voice.

Hmm? This voice... sounds familiar.

Chu Shangli, who had been observing how Chu Moyin controlled the strength of his legs, finally looked up at the face of the person standing behind him.

Huh? How could this possibly be—?!

Isn’t this person Ouyang Huanshi, the daughter of Zi Shuhui, the head of the Zishu family, and Ouyang Shixian, the head of the Ouyang family, among the six major families?

The six major families of the empire are the Weisheng family, the Zishu family, the Gongyi family, the Ouyang family, the Xiahou family and the Chu family. Each of the six families controls different industries in the empire. Each family basically dominates the field it controls, and the combined power controls more than half of the empire.

The Xiahou family, which mastered medicine and cutting-edge technology, was uprooted decades ago due to deep-seated darkness. The entire family was destroyed, and its industries were divided up by other families. Although the major families of the empire are still mentioned as six major families, there are actually only five that still exist.

Since the five major families each controlled different industries within the empire, they were not superior to each other when considered individually. However, if we were to actually talk about their origins, there was probably no one in the empire who could compare to Ouyang Huanshi.

Ouyang Huanshi is the only product of the powerful alliance of two family heads - the only one from the past to the present.

It was not uncommon for the six families to intermarry out of their own interests. However, for the other families, intermarriage between two heads of families was obviously quite dangerous and might even be enough to destroy the balance of power in the empire. If two families had initially considered intermarriage between two heads of families, they would certainly have been obstructed by other families to some extent.

The successful marriage between Zi Shuhui and Ouyang Shixian was not due to the kindness of other families who respected true love, but because

The Zishu family originally chose someone else as the head of the family, and Zishuhui was the second heir. It was said that the first heir was unmatched in character, appearance, and talent. Although Zishuhui was also excellent, he pales in comparison. The Zishu family was reluctant to see this golden opportunity go to waste, so they arranged for Zishuhui to marry into the Ouyang Shixian family.

No one could have imagined that the young, highly regarded talent would, a few years later, be driven mad by such irritation, slaughtering the entire Zishu family and disappearing shortly thereafter. When they were found, they were already dead. Zishuhui, who had no hope of inheriting the family business, naturally became the new head of the family, and his and his wife's daughter became the most pampered daughter in the entire empire.

Zi Shuhui and Ouyang Shixian are both gentle and elegant people, but unfortunately their daughter Ouyang Huanshi is the most arrogant and conceited - she acts recklessly in Meisuo Academy and often bullies others outside.

In her previous life, her end was that she was too domineering and killed someone. After being sentenced to death, she used her family's power to escape from prison, but was eventually ruthlessly killed by her enemies on the way.
